The length of a rectangle is three times its width. If the perimeter of the rectangle is 80

Answer:

Let width is y;

The length of a rectangle is three times its width

length = 3 x width

= 3y

If the perimeter of the rectangle is 80

perimeter of the rectangle = 80

2(length + width) =80

2(3y + y) =80

2(4y)= 80

8y = 80

y=80/8

y= 10

width = y= 10

length = 3y =30
